Transaction 8d4f76f39c6e769239f283885d3d277454495084f868662f64aee0cac73af84a
1 Input
2 Outputs
- 8d4f76f39c6e769239f283885d3d277454495084f868662f64aee0cac73af84a:0
- 8d4f76f39c6e769239f283885d3d277454495084f868662f64aee0cac73af84a:1
value 20000000
address 3ArHphMDFJBCkfCFa6oEqce9a11ZAx1Xde
value 83574563
address 1CoGkZ4gX6kvfg1y1b2u1enABnfjkHExKH